Myopia: An Unknown Pandemic

Myopia is a type of refractive error in which the person is not able to focus the distance objects clearly. The increasing incidence of myopia in children has become like a pandemic and is a major health concern among the parents.Increasing myopia rates have been influenced by many ...

"Clear Vision Ahead: 7 Simple Tips to Banish Dry Eyes!"

Dry eyes can be an uncomfortable and frustrating condition, often resulting from environmental factors, prolonged screen time, or underlying health issues.Dry eyes can show symptoms like sensitivity to light,redness,gritty sensation,burning sensation,irritation and sometimes blurring of vision ...

Understanding Color Blindness: Common Symptoms

Color blindness, medically known as color vision deficiency, is a condition that affects how individuals perceive and distinguish colors. It's more common in men than in women and can range from mild to severe. Here are five key symptoms to watch for:Difficulty Differentiating Colors: ...
